TRACE
3-18x50mm R3
TRACE β delivering everything you need and nothing you donβt, to execute the most precise and technical shooting results in the most challenging conditions.
- Zero Stop
- R3 SFP reticle
- 30mm tube
- Glass etched reticle
- HD alloy flip-up covers
- Half Magnification Index (HMI)
- Precision Turret System (PTS)
- 92% Light Transmission
- Weathershield lens coating

The zero tech trace 3-18Γ50 with the r3 reticle is buy far the best bang for buck in its class tracks 100% both on elevation and windage glass quality is on point fit and finish is top quality also. Zero stop is a must have in my opinion these days and the zero stop in this scope is easy to set and rock solid and also the locking turrets are a great feature. Magnification ring and parallax ring are smooth as butter. And last but not least the alloy flip up caps are a sweet touch if I had to say one criticism it would be the windage turret I would like to see the numbers go left and right and not 1 through 19 cheers for the great optics
